What is Vision Therapy Symptom Questionnaire

The Vision and Learning Therapy Monitoring Symptom Questionnaire is a patient consent form used by parents to evaluate their child's symptoms and behaviors related to vision and learning.

What is the Vision and Learning Therapy Monitoring Symptom Questionnaire?

The Vision and Learning Therapy Monitoring Symptom Questionnaire serves as a crucial tool for parents to assess their child's symptoms related to vision and learning. By utilizing this questionnaire, parents can effectively track various symptoms, including eye discomfort and reading difficulties. Monitoring these symptoms helps in understanding the overall vision and learning health of their child, making this tool relevant for early detection and timely intervention.
This symptom questionnaire addresses a wide array of child vision symptoms, enabling parents to gain insights into their child's experience and challenges.
